"Call on Me" is an R&B song released as the first single from Janet Jackson's ninth studio album, 20 Years Old. The North American radio impact date was June 19 2006.
The music video for "Call on Me" began filming on June 28 in Los Angeles, directed by Hype Williams. [1] According to Jermaine Dupri, the shoot will take between five to six days and could end up being "the most expensive video in the past three years." [2] It will debut on July 26.
Song information
"Call on Me" is a mid-tempo song featuring rapper Nelly and samples the S.O.S. Band's "Tell Me If You Still Care." [3] "It's really just a record about when you need a friend, somebody you need to talk to, just call on a person. It's a friend record. It really is not a boyfriend/girlfriend record. The way Nelly and Janet are talking is more girlfriend/boyfriend, but it really goes out to friends", said producer Jermaine Dupri.[4]
Video information
The music video shoot for "Call on Me" took five days to complete (June 28-July 1, 2006), and was filmed inside a hanger at Santa Monica Airport, by director, Hype Williams. Janet has five different looks, including African, Asian, and Indian styles, with a mixture of elaborate hairstyles. The video is a mixture of live action and animation and was inspired by the Aesop's Fables children's tales. Jackson was keen on creating the types of videos she "used to do." The result, an all-out, exotic piece, which producer Jermaine Dupri announced would be, "the most "expensive video of the last three years." Jackson was joined by duet partner, Nelly on the set and is a featured player as well. The video will premiere on BET on July 28, 2006.
Chart performance
The song premiered on Z100 on June 17 2006. In the United States, the song was played 184 times two days prior to its official release, on four different formats of radio, generating an audience impression of 4.358 million. By its official radio release, it achieved 8.679 million audience impressions.
"Call on Me" debuted on the Bubbling Under Hot 100 Singles at number eight which is equal to 108 on the Hot 100. The song also debuted at #48 on the Hot R&B/Hip-Hop Songs chart, the highest debut of the week, after only two days of official release. The following week, the song debuted on the Billboard Radio Monitor R&B/Hip-Hop Airplay chart at number 19, the highest debut since TLC's "No Scrubs", which debuted at number 13 in February 1999.
"Call on Me" was released on iTunes on July 18 2006.
